지역농업 클러스터의 추진사례에 관한 연구 - 아산시 자원순환형 친환경지역농업 클러스터를 중심으로 - (A Case Study on the Regional Agricultural Cluster at Asan Area)

  • Regional Agricultural Cluster(RAC) at Asan area has been formed with Purundeul farming union corporation(Purundeul) as the center from the year 2005. Originally, RAC has been proceeded by Ministry for Food, Agriculture, Forestry and Fisheries (MFAFF) all over the nation from 2005. This RAC has helped Asan area to establish the foundation of environmentally friendly agriculture(EFA) searching for nutritional cycle. This also made jumping age turn developing age in EFA at Asan area. The number of Purundeul producer members was 386 farmers in 2008. Purundeul introduced organic livestock farming(Korean beef cattle; Hanwoo) for proceeding EFA searching for nutritional cycle in 2007, and had 719 cattle at the end of March 2009. Feedstuff materials for organic livestock is mostly produced from seeding farming by-products within Asan or the country. Asan RAC had built factories for feedstuff producing and beef processing with producers' investment.

Cross-Sectional Study on Iron Status of Asan Residents and Regional Comparison

  • Iron deficiency and anemia are severe nutrition problems in most of Korea. Iron intake, especially iron with better bioavailability is insufficient over a total age group. Recent changes in diet and life style of Koreans have been repeatedly suggested problems caused by excess nutrient intake rather than under intake. Despite the changes in diet patterns, iron deficient anemia is still prevalent in many parts of Korea. Eight hundred and fifty subjects (323 male and 527 female subjects) in Asan were recruited from farming, factory and urban area. Each subject was interviewed to assess nutrients intakes according to a 24hr-recall method. Twelve hour fasting blood samples were collected to vacutainer with EDTA for hemoglobin (Hb) and separate the tubes for serum iron (SI) and total iron binding capacity (TIBC). The mean serum iron value of female subjects in the factory area was significantly higher (p < 0.05) than that of the female subjects in the urban area although subjects in urban area showed significantly higher the dietary iron intake for both the men and woman (p < 0.05). Dietary iron intake for the younger women was lowest in the farming area and those in the urban area showed the highest dietary iron intake (p < 0.05). When the dietary iron intake was compared by different the age groups, dietary iron intake of the older women from animal sources was less than that of younger women in the urban area (p < 0.05). Dietary iron intake of Asan residents was not sufficient regardless of age, sex and regions and intake of heme iron was especially lower than nonheme iron. (J Community Nutrition 5(1) : 37∼43, 2003)

농촌유역의 산림지 면적 감소에 따른 유역 토양유실량 변화 추정 (Estimation of the Forestry Area Decrease Effect on the Soil Erosion in Rural Watershed)

  • In this paper, forestry area change effect on the soil erosion in Asan lake watershed was estimated. Temporal variations of land use in the study watershed were analyzed from Landsat-5 TM remote sensing images. Geographic Information System (GIS) combined with Universal Soil Loss Equation (USLE) was used to estimate the soil erosion of Asan lake watershed. Spatial data for each USLE factors was obtained from the Landsat-5 TM remote sensing images and 1/25,000 scale digital contour maps. Sediment yield to Asan lake was estimated by sediment delivery ratio and sediment accumulation in lake was estimated by trap efficiency. The estimation methods were validated for sediment accumulation in Asan lake. From the hydrographic survey from 1974 to 2003 for Asan lake, sediment accumulation was measured. The estimated accumulation sediment of 303,569ton/yr showed similar value with observed of 295,888ton/yr. From the validated estimation methods, the increasing amount of soil erosion when 1% of forest area in Asan lake watershed decreases was calculated from 12.91 to 1482.05ton/yr.

천안·아산지역 양봉농가 꿀벌질병 감염률 조사 (Prevalence of honeybee (Apis mellifera) disease in Cheonan-Asan areas, Korea)

  • This study was carried out to investigate the prevalence of honeybee (Apis mellifera) disease in cheonan and asan area. From September to November in 2012, 33 samples were collected from 33 apiculture farms in the regions and reverse transcriptase-polymerase chain reaction (RT-PCR) and polymerase chain reaction (PCR) was conducted. Among 33 samples, prevalence rate was 42% in Sac Brood Virus (SBV), 52% in Nosema, 21% in American foulbrood (AFB), 70% in European foulbrood (EFB), 97% in Stonebrood, 3% in Chalkbrood. The result indicate that stonebrood was most prevalent disease in apiculture farms in cheonan and asan area.

아산지역 도로변의 $NO_2$ 및 TSP 농도에 관한 연구 (A study on $NO_2$ and TSP levels of the Major Trunk Road in Asan-area)

  • The atmospheric concentrations of Nitrogen Dioxide ($NO_2$) and Total Suspended Particulates (TSP) at the traffic road side were measured n Asan area, Choongchumg-namdo during May 1998 and January, 1999.The results of the study are as follows;1. The aversge value of airbone $NO_2$ and TSP levels were 28.5ppb and 5.9mg/me in Asan area. 2. The concentration distribution of NO2 and TSP is high for the season of winter. On a daily pattern, somewhat high value is appeared in the afternoon. 3. For the station, terminal, and Shinchang, the average value of $NO_2$ is 33.6ppb, 27.9ppb and 24.1ppb in sequence, and the ones of TSP is 6.3mg/m3, 6.0mg/m3 and 5.3mg/m3 in order.4. The high levels of $NO_2$ and TSP were positively related to traffic volume.

Metal Concentrations in atmospheric particulate from seoul and asan, in Korea

  • Daily average concentrations of fine particulates have been measured simultaneously in Seoul and Asan area by using PM minivolTM portable air sampler(Air Metrics, U.S.A) from September 2001 to August 2002. The sampler were analyzed by ICP-OES(inductively coupled plasma optical emission spectrometry, optima 3000DV, Perkin Elmor) to determine the fine particulate concentrations of metallic elements(As, Mn. Ni, Fe, Cr, Cu, Cd, Pb, Zn, Si). The concentration of PM$\sub$2.5/ showed a high trend in the Seoul area. Zn showed a similar distribution ratio for the fine particle in both Seoul and Asan. Mn and Fe, Cr, Cd are highly correlated in the Seoul and Asan area(P<0.05).

아산지역에서의 연약지반개량을 위한 시험시공 결과에 대한 평가 (An Evaluation on the Result of Pilot Test for Soft Grounnd Improvement in Asan)

  • This paper is relate to the result of pilot test in Asan. In order to evaluate the characteristics of behavior and deformation in Asan and to analyse the effect of soft ground treatment, preloading, two types of paper drain and pack drain were constructed in the ground. Settlement gauges, pressure meters, pressure cells and ground water gauges were monitored and also borings and piezoncone tests were performed. As a result of analyse, every vertical drained area was consolidated over 90% degree of consolidation but preloaded area was not reached to 90%.

Intraoperative monitoring of cortico-cortical evoked potentials of the frontal aslant tract in a patient with oligodendroglioma

  • The newly identified frontal aslant tract (FAT) that connects the posterior Broca's area to the supplementary motor area is known to be involved in speech and language functions. We successfully intraoperatively monitored FAT using cortico-cortical evoked potentials generated by single-pulse electrical cortical stimulation in a patient with oligodendroglioma.

A Study on Indoor and Personal Exposures Concentrations to Carbon Monoxide in the Asan Area

  • Indoor carbon monoxide (CO) concentration and personal CO exposures were measured Asan where CO poisoning from twenty coal usage briquette as a domestic fuel to cook and space heating. Twenty-five were houses selected from the Asan area for the survey conducted in February 1997. Newly developed passive CO samplers were placed in the kitchen and living room for the indoor concentration measurement and were worn by homemakers for personal exposure monitoring. The daily average of indoor CO concentration was 16ppm in the kitchen and 10ppm in the living room. The indoor concentration and personal exposures to CO were different in types of the space heating system. House ventilating methods and socioeconomic conditions were also important factors in determining the indoor and personal CO level in Asan.

아산지역에서 산업재료의 대기부식속도 측정 (Atmospheric corrosion rate and corrosivity categories of industrial metals in Asan area)

  • 4년간 아산지역에서 5가지 산업재료의 부식속도를 측정하였다. 이 연구는 전국의 21개 지역을 농촌, 해안, 공업도시로 구분하여 그 중 아산지역에서 시편을 대기에 노출 시켰을 때의 부식속도를 알아보고 이를 산업용으로 사용되는 금속의 Database로 하고자 하였다. 실험에 사용된 시편은 산업재료로 많이 사용되는 알루미늄, 구리, 탄소강, 내후성강, 아연도강이다. 탄소강과 내후성강의 부식속도와 무게감소량이 다른 금속에 비해 높았으며 sanding 처리한 시편의 부식속도가 sanding처리하지 않은 시편보다 부식속도가 낮게 나타났다. 아산 지역의 평균 Corrosion categories는 3으로 나타났다. 아산지역의 Corrosion categories는 해안지역보다는 낮게 나타났으며 농촌지역보다는 높게 나타났다. 염화물 이온의 농도가 커짐에 따라 부식속도가 커지는 경향을 나타낸다.
